One of the most distinctive features of GIS is its compact design, which offers a significant advantage over traditional air-insulated switchgear. The use of insulating gas such as sulfur hexafluoride (SF6) allows for smaller physical dimensions, making it ideal for installations in urban environments where space is limited. Manufacturers have focused on providing scalable solutions, where modular designs facilitate easy expansion and adapt to evolving needs. This space efficiency not only reduces initial capital investment but also minimizes land use and lowers maintenance costs in the long term.

Another critical component of GIS is the circuit breaker, which is pivotal for managing electrical flow and protecting equipment from overloads and faults. High-quality manufacturers invest in advanced circuit breaker technology, integrating intelligent control systems that enhance operational efficiency. Features such as quick tripping mechanisms and real-time monitoring capabilities provide utilities with tools to respond swiftly to faults, further ensuring grid stability. Moreover, the need for minimal maintenance due to the sealed environment of GIS systems translates into lower operational costs for utility companies.

The insulation property of the primary and secondary busbars, which transport electrical current within the switchgear, is another crucial aspect that GIS manufacturers continuously improve. These busbars are designed to withstand high voltage while minimizing losses. By employing advanced materials and engineering techniques, leading manufacturers enhance the conductive materials' effectiveness, ensuring longevity and reliability. This technological innovation also contributes to increased energy efficiency, as reduced losses equate to lower operational costs and a smaller carbon footprint.

Additionally, the monitoring and control systems integrated into GIS offer substantial advantages. Modern manufacturers are leveraging IoT and smart technology to provide real-time data analytics and predictive maintenance capabilities. These innovations allow utilities to anticipate potential issues before they escalate, minimizing downtime and maximizing operational efficiency. The ability to remotely monitor and manage GIS systems also enhances flexibility in operations, allowing utilities to respond to demand fluctuations quickly and effectively.

From a safety perspective, the insulating gas used in GIS inherently reduces the risk of electrical arcing and short circuits. Furthermore, top manufacturers comply with strict environmental regulations regarding the use and disposal of SF6, ensuring sustainable practices within the industry. Rigorous safety standards and certifications are often a hallmark of reputable manufacturers, providing utilities with peace of mind regarding the reliability and safety of their installations.
